然而,在实际工作中,我们往往会遇到需要在旧版操作系统上运行特定软件的情况
特别是对于一些依赖Windows XP系统的老旧应用,如何在最新的Windows 7专业版环境中实现兼容运行,成为了一个亟待解决的问题
本文将深入探讨如何在Windows 7专业版上通过虚拟机技术安装并运行Windows XP,以实现高效兼容的解决方案
一、虚拟机技术概述 虚拟机(Virtual Machine, VM)技术是一种通过软件模拟出具有完整硬件功能的计算机系统的技术
它允许用户在一台物理计算机上同时运行多个操作系统,这些操作系统被封装在独立的虚拟机中,互不干扰
虚拟机技术不仅解决了操作系统兼容性问题,还极大地提高了资源利用率和灵活性
在Windows 7专业版上,我们可以利用VMware Workstation、VirtualBox、Microsoft Virtual PC等虚拟机软件来创建和运行Windows XP虚拟机
这些软件提供了直观易用的界面,使得虚拟机的创建、配置和管理变得相对简单
二、选择虚拟机软件 在选择虚拟机软件时,我们需要考虑以下几个因素: 1.兼容性:确保所选软件能够兼容Windows 7专业版,并且支持Windows XP的安装和运行
2.性能:虚拟机软件的性能直接影响虚拟机的运行速度和稳定性
选择性能优异的软件可以确保虚拟机的高效运行
3.易用性:友好的用户界面和丰富的功能可以简化虚拟机的创建和管理过程
4.安全性:虚拟机软件应具备有效的隔离机制,以防止虚拟机与宿主机之间的恶意软件传播
综合以上因素,VMware Workstation和VirtualBox是两款较为流行的虚拟机软件
VMware Workstation以其强大的性能和丰富的功能著称,而VirtualBox则以其开源免费和易用性受到用户的青睐
根据实际需求,用户可以选择适合自己的虚拟机软件
三、创建Windows XP虚拟机 以下是在Windows 7专业版上利用VMware Workstation创建Windows XP虚拟机的详细步骤: 1.安装虚拟机软件:首先,下载并安装所选的虚拟机软件(以VMware Workstation为例)
2.创建新虚拟机:打开VMware Workstation,选择“创建新的虚拟机”
在向导中,选择“典型(推荐)”安装类型,然后点击“下一步”
3.选择操作系统:在操作系统选择界面中,选择“Microsoft Windows”作为操作系统族,并在版本列表中选择“Windows XP Professional”
点击“下一步”继续
4.分配虚拟机名称和位置:为虚拟机命名,并选择其存储位置
点击“下一步”进入下一步配置
5.配置处理器和内存:根据宿主机的硬件配置,为虚拟机分配适当的处理器数量和内存大小
通常,为Windows XP虚拟机分配1-2个处理器核心和1GB内存即可满足大部分需求
6.配置网络连接:选择虚拟机的网络连接方式
常用的有桥接模式(虚拟机与宿主机在同一网络中)、NAT模式(虚拟机通过宿主机访问外部网络)和仅主机模式(虚拟机与宿主机之间建立私有网络)
根据实际需求选择合适的网络连接方式
7.创建虚拟硬盘:选择“创建新虚拟硬盘”,并设置其容量和存储格式
通常,为Windows XP虚拟机分配20-40GB的虚拟硬盘空间即可
点击“下一步”完成虚拟硬盘的创建
8.安装操作系统:完成虚拟机的配置后,点击“完成”按钮
此时,VMware Workstation将启动虚拟机并进入BIOS设置界面
在BIOS中,确保虚拟机的启动顺序正确(通常从光驱或ISO镜像文件启动)
然后,插入Windows XP安装光盘或加载ISO镜像文件,开始安装操作系统
9.完成安装:按照Windows XP安装向导的提示完成操作系统的安装
在安装过程中,可能需要输入产品密钥、选择安装分区和进行一些基本配置
四、优化虚拟机性能 为了提高Windows XP虚拟机的运行效率,我们可以进行以下优化操作: 1.调整虚拟机设置:根据宿主机的硬件配置和实际需求,调整虚拟机的处理器数量、内存大小、虚拟硬盘缓存等设置
2.安装VMware Tools:在Windows XP虚拟机中安装VMware Tools可以显著提高虚拟机的性能,包括图形显示、鼠标指针同步、时间同步等方面
3.关闭不必要的服务:在Windows XP虚拟机中,关闭一些不必要的系统服务和启动项可以减轻系统负担,提高运行效率
4.更新驱动程序:确保Windows XP虚拟机中的硬件驱动程序是最新的,特别是显卡、声卡和网络适配器等关键硬件的驱动程序
五、虚拟机在实际应用中的优势 通过虚拟机技术在Windows 7专业版上运行Windows XP,我们可以获得以下优势: 1.兼容性:虚拟机解决了操作系统之间的兼容性问题,使得我们可以在最新的操作系统环境中运行老旧应用
2.资源隔离:虚拟机提供了有效的资源隔离机制,确保了宿主机和虚拟机之间的安全性和稳定性
3.灵活性:虚拟机允许我们在同一台物理计算机上同时运行多个操作系统,提高了资源的利用率和灵活性
4.便于管理:虚拟机软件提供了直观易用的管理界面,使得虚拟机的创建、配置和管理变得相对简单
六、结论 在Windows 7专业版上通过虚拟机技术安装并运行Windows XP是一种高效兼容的解决方案
它解决了操作系统之间的兼容性问题,提高了资源的利用率和灵活性,同时也确保了系统的安全性和稳定性
通过合理的配置和优化操作,我们可以充分发挥虚拟机技术的优势,为老旧应用提供稳定可靠的运行环境
随着虚拟机技术的不断发展和完善,相信未来将有更多的应用场景和解决方案涌现出来,为我们的工作和生活带来更多便利
麒麟V10安装Win7虚拟机教程
Win7专业版安装XP虚拟机指南
台式电脑搭建私有云全攻略
Win10上安装虚拟机XP的可行性探讨
电脑云部署软件教程全攻略
云电脑软件能否畅玩方舟生存进化
Win10系统下轻松开启虚拟机:全面指南与步骤解析
麒麟V10安装Win7虚拟机教程
Win7虚拟机安装及下载教程
VIDA win7虚拟机安装与使用教程
Win7虚拟机安装Linux系统教程
Win7共享设置,虚拟机互联全攻略
Win7双虚拟机网络配置指南
Win7下轻松搭建XP虚拟机教程
“虚拟机中Win7系统激活码获取指南与注意事项”
Win7装虚拟机后电脑卡顿解决指南
小牛win7虚拟机安装教程指南
Win7虚拟机下载地址大全,一键获取官方安全版安装资源
VM虚拟机安装Win7遇阻解决方案